What Exactly Is Indoor Air Quality Testing?

Indoor air quality testing thoroughly evaluates indoor environments to determine contaminant levels, assess ventilation performance, and locate emission sources that affect occupant health and comfort. The process reveals numerous airborne threats including particulate matter (PM2.5), volatile organic compounds (VOCs), mold spores, formaldehyde, elevated carbon dioxide, and naturally occurring radon. Tightly constructed modern homes contain emissions from furnishings, cleaning supplies, heating equipment, and daily-use items, often resulting in concentrations far exceeding outdoor baselines. Professional-grade indoor air quality testing utilizes precision instruments, extended-period sampling tools, and certified laboratory methods to produce unbiased, evidence-based data that consumer-grade DIY options simply cannot equal in precision or comprehensiveness.

According to guidelines from authoritative sources, indoor pollution arises from both internal sources (such as off-gassing materials) and external infiltration (traffic exhaust or wildfire particulates), with insufficient ventilation amplifying exposure risks. Certified technicians follow standardized methodologies to ensure results are reliable, repeatable, and actionable. This level of precision facilitates exact location of trouble spots, empowering property owners to execute focused solutions that restore healthy indoor conditions and prevent future degradation.

How Indoor Air Quality Differs from Outdoor Air

Outdoor air experiences ongoing dispersion and dilution via natural air movement and weather, dispersing pollutants rapidly. In contrast, indoor areas often experience minimal fresh air circulation, especially in energy-efficient modern construction, leading to accumulation of VOCs, ultrafine particles, and bioaerosols. This variation explains the more significant symptoms often reported indoors despite acceptable outdoor air quality readings. Inadequately serviced HVAC equipment may perpetuate contaminant circulation, establishing ongoing exposure patterns.

What Are the Most Common Indoor Air Pollutants in Southern California Homes?

The pollutant profile in Southern California residences reflects a complex interplay of environmental, traffic-related, and household-generated contaminants. Particulate matter (PM2.5) from wildfire events infiltrates structures and persists in HVAC systems, while volatile organic compounds (VOCs) continuously off-gas from paints, furnishings, and household cleaners. Formaldehyde emerges from composite wood products and insulation materials, mold spores proliferate in humid microenvironments, and elevated carbon dioxide levels indicate inadequate fresh air exchange. These contaminants interact synergistically, frequently resulting in compounded exposure risks that present as ongoing discomfort, respiratory problems, or impaired thinking ability.

Particulate Matter (PM2.5) and Wildfire Smoke Impact

PM2.5 particles measure 2.5 micrometers or smaller and travel far into the lungs, causing inflammation and worsening pre-existing breathing issues. During and after wildfire seasons, wildfire particulates infiltrate homes through openings, vents, and HVAC systems, leaving behind particles that keep emitting irritants long after external levels drop.

Settled contaminants become airborne again through walking, air circulation, and routine living, maintaining elevated indoor concentrations long after external smoke dissipates. Professional sampling records these ongoing fluctuations, generating insights that inform efficient corrective measures.

Health Effects on Children and Seniors

Children and elderly individuals face greater vulnerability due to developing or declining respiratory systems, resulting in increased asthma episodes, reduced lung function, and greater susceptibility to cardiovascular complications from sustained PM2.5 exposure.

Volatile Organic Compounds (VOCs) and Formaldehyde

VOCs evaporate from many common products such as paints, glues, cleaners, and personal hygiene items, contributing to eye, nose, and throat irritation, headaches, and dizziness. Formaldehyde, considered a probable carcinogen to humans, releases from composite wood materials, insulation products, and fabrics, posing special risks in new or recently renovated buildings during the highest emission phase.

Mold Spores, Allergens, and Humidity Issues

Elevated humidity levels—common in coastal Southern California—create ideal conditions for mold spores, dust mites, and other biological allergens to thrive in hidden locations such as wall cavities, attics, and HVAC systems. These biological contaminants trigger allergic reactions, asthma exacerbations, and immune system responses in sensitive individuals, especially in areas near the ocean or with higher moisture.

Carbon Dioxide, Radon, and Ventilation Indicators

Elevated carbon dioxide levels act as dependable indicators of insufficient air exchange, corresponding to buildup of additional pollutants and decreased mental clarity. Radon, a colorless, odorless radioactive gas, enters structures from underlying soil in specific geological formations and collects in lower levels, necessitating specific monitoring to evaluate chronic exposure potential.

The 3 Major Types of Indoor Air Quality Testing Techniques

Expert practitioners employ three fundamental methodologies to gather comprehensive data: continuous monitoring, composite sampling, and targeted contaminant-specific testing. These complementary approaches ensure thorough coverage of both instantaneous conditions and time-weighted average exposures.

Real-Time Monitoring and Instrumentation

Handheld, accurate devices provide instant readings of particulate matter (PM2.5), carbon dioxide, relative humidity, temperature, and volatile gases, enabling rapid identification of acute problem areas and dynamic changes during occupancy.

Integrated Sampling with Laboratory Analysis

Extended-duration sampling equipment gathers air across longer timeframes (hours to days), providing average concentration data that laboratory analysis then quantifies with exceptional accuracy for VOCs, mold spores, and other complex mixtures.

Targeted Contaminant-Specific Testing

When certain pollutants are suggested by health complaints, building characteristics, or area-specific risks, focused methodologies target critical concerns such as radon or formaldehyde, delivering definitive results for high-priority concerns.

How Much Does Indoor Air Quality Testing Cost in Southern California?

Indoor air quality testing pricing depends on extent and geographic area. Standard residential evaluations generally range from $300 to $800, including standard contaminant screening with fundamental sampling and lab analysis. More extensive packages that incorporate multiple sampling locations, specialized contaminant panels, wildfire-related residue analysis, or larger commercial spaces typically fall between $1,000 and $2,000 or higher.

Breakdown of Standard vs Comprehensive Packages

Standard evaluations concentrate on common contaminants like PM2.5 and VOCs, whereas advanced packages extend to cover formaldehyde, radon, in-depth mold identification, and post-remediation confirmation.

What Influences the Final Price

Square footage, sampling point count, time constraints, travel distance, and extra specialized procedures affect final pricing while upholding straightforward pricing policies.
